Sorry, you have to be of legal age to sign a contract. That could be 18 or 21 depending upon the state you live in.
No. No company or bank for that matter is going to extend credit to a minor. They would not be able to legally recoup their loses if you did not pay your debt.

No you can't. Credit Card companies will not make agreements with under age people because the contracts are voidable. They will insist that the cards are the parents responsibility.
